A Road Called Adoption
Book Description
The purpose of this book is to share with the reader the far-reaching implications of adoption, and to lend some insight into the predicaments of the parties involved. Rather than write a series of case studies, the authors chose to blend their knowledge into stories, in which the reader is invited 'inside' of the characters, to experience with them their confusions, fears and joys.
